Ocean Pond Campground
Situated in Baker County, Florida, this campground includes 64 campsites and is open 24 hours/day. All sites are available at recreation.gov. There's something here for everyone in this lakeside campground. The Florida National Scenic Trail provides hiking opportunity adjacent to this campground. Come play, fish, swim, view wildlife and enjoy the outdoors here on the north shore of Ocean Pond!. Boating is very popular on Ocean Pond, and multiple campsites provide lakeside access for swimming, boating, and fishing. Speckled perch and largemouth bass are popular targets for anglers. A boat ramp is also available here.

Amenities & rules
Fees: Cash is not accepted here. Payments for ADVANCE RESERVATION campsites must be made at the Rec.gov webpage. Payments for First-Come, First-Served SCAN & PAY campsites must be made through the Recreation.gov app.

Getting there
From Lake City, Florida, head east on US Hwy 90 for approximately 14 miles. Turn left (north) on CR 250/FR 266 and drive approximately 4 miles. Turn left onto FR 268 (campground entrance road). Follow FR 268 for approximately 1.1 miles until you reach the entrance to the campground.
